Rep. Mia Love Blasts Trump in Concession Speech

HeadlineNov 27, 2018

Utah Republican Congressmember Mia Love slammed President Trump in a concession speech Monday, after losing her congressional seat to Democrat and Salt Lake County Mayor Ben McAdams. This is Rep. Love responding to a question about Trump’s lack of support for her campaign.

Rep. Mia Love: “This gave me a clear vision of his world as it is: no real relationships, just convenient transactions. That is an insufficient way to implement sincere service and policy.”

In 2014, Mia Love became the first—and only—black woman Republican ever elected to Congress. In her concession speech, she blasted her party for failing to reach out to voters of color. After the midterm elections, Trump blamed Republican losses on their refusal to “embrace” him.

President Donald Trump: “Those are some of the people that, you know, decided, for their own reason, not to embrace—whether it’s me or what we stand for. Mia Love gave me no love. … And she lost. Too bad. Sorry about that, Mia.”
